Emi Motokawa (born October 4, 1976), better known by her ring name Emi Sakura, is a Japanese professional wrestler. She has owned and operated the Japanese promotion ChocoPro (formerally Gatoh Move Pro Wrestling) since 2012, and makes occasional appearances for American promotion All Elite Wrestling (AEW) and across the Japanese independent scene. After starting her career in the International Wrestling Association of Japan (IWA Japan), Sakura worked for several promotions across the country, before founding her own promotion, Ice Ribbon. She went on to become a two-time ICE×60 Champion and a then-record five-time International Ribbon Tag Team Champion, and was the promotion's primary trainer of new talent, before leaving in 2011. Sakura also held top singles and tag team championships in JWP Joshi Puroresu (JWP) and NEO Japan Ladies Pro Wrestling (NEO), which lead her to winning the 2009 Tokyo Sports Joshi Puroresu Grand Prize.
